I've made the double check and used netcraft to examine one of my servers.
The results are different from the request for cobalt-images seen so far:
wooster.netcraft.com - - [27/Jul/2001:13:07:03 +0200] "HEAD / HTTP/1.1"
200 0 "http://www.netcraft.com/survey/" "Mozilla/4.0 (compatible; Netcraft Web Server Survey)"
jumble.netcraft.com - - [28/Jul/2001:23:57:51 +0200] "HEAD / HTTP/1.0"
200 0 "http://www.netcraft.com/survey/" "Mozilla/4.0 (compatible; Netcraft Web Server Survey)"
> Appearantly somebody just used netcraft to see more information about your
> server :)
> So no worries :)
So it isn't the normal probe that everbody can use, but something special.
Speculations about the intended usage of the data are left to the reader.
